1. Business Operating Model
• AI-Powered Language Solutions: Provides AI-driven language translation and localization services for businesses across various sectors.
• Cloud-Based Platform: Operates a user-friendly platform that enables clients to manage their translation projects and access a network of linguists efficiently.
• Scalable Services: Offers solutions that can easily scale according to the volume and complexity of client needs, accommodating both small projects and large enterprises.
• Quality Assurance Processes: Implements rigorous quality checks and feedback loops to ensure accuracy and cultural relevance in translations.

3. Revenue Model
• Translation Fees: Primary revenue from charging clients based on the volume and complexity of translation projects.
• Subscription Services: Offers ongoing services on a subscription basis for businesses requiring regular translation and localization.
• Consulting Fees: Revenue generated from consulting services related to language strategy and localization best practices.
• Partnerships and Collaborations: Income from collaborations with other tech firms and language service providers to enhance service offerings.
